  • As for the blue one, would that look any better with the blue info block removed at all? Or is it still too much?

    Many thanks mate 😁

    @jac I think it’s too much because of the header being the same colour. A blue of they shade will only work if there is something in between it. It’s made much worse as the thread gets longer.

    When the page is scrolled, the title is set to sticky meaning that it’s always visible at the top of the screen. This means the colour is never out of view and is then dominant.

    The yellow is a better choice as it’s not being used anywhere else in the thread and as a result won’t look overdone.
